Our users have a default email address defined and a number of additional alias SMTP address created. The problem is that if an email is sent to an external address and an internal address the external recipient see's a different email address than the default one for the internal recipient. Make sense?
Is there a way in Exchange or Outlook to ensure that external emails only show the default email address for any internal recipients defined by the sender?
